"Mennonite Brethren Herald" obituary: 2008 Apr p. 34

Birth date: 1953 Dec 14

text of obituary:

GERALD (GERRY) WAYNE PENNER

Gerald (Gerry) Wayne Penner died Nov. 8, 2007 at age 53. He was born Dec. 14, 1953 to John and Anne Penner in St. Catharines, Ont. He moved to Man. at 19 to attend Winkler Bible School and later settled in Winnipeg. He worked various jobs in Winnipeg and was employed with Centra Gas and Manitoba Hydro for 27 years. He enjoyed many sports including golf, cross country skiing, and hockey. He was a caring, loving person who had many friends, with some friendships spanning over thirty years. Friends at Beginning Experience will miss his caring smile and kind words. Gerry had a strong faith in God, which gave him courage and hope during his recent illness. He is mourned by his wife Linda Mulvey; children Sam and Rita; stepsons Colin (Candace) and Andrew Campbell; 4 siblings.
